Description

One boar food device
Technical field
The utility model relates to pig feeding apparatus field, particularly relates to a boar food device.
Background technology
As everyone knows, in the process of feeding pig, traditional feeding pattern that animal feeds bucket spoon is fed is carried in general employing on the shoulder, this artificial feeding pattern not only consumes a large amount of manpower and materials, especially in large-scale plant, artificial feeding mode has been difficult to huge workload, and when throwing in feed, the amount thrown in also respectively is had any different, and requires if do not have the estimation of enough experiences not reach scientific culture.
Along with the development that China's pig industry is swift and violent, import and export pork in the world and occupied main status, pig industry has become the important industry of China's agricultural and rural economy.Though China has been big country of raising pigs, be not power of raising pigs, compared with world standard, level of raising pigs or on the low side, its problem is mainly manifested in: the rate of animals delivered to the slaughter-house is low, and feedstuff-meat ratio is high, and labor productivity is low.And cause China's lower reason of level of raising pigs to also have, kind, nutrient fodder and feeding and management and facility such as to fall behind at the factor.In the piggery comparatively fallen behind, swinery often occurs during nursing and clusters round feeding point, cause and rob food, cause pig feed amount uneven, what have eats too much, and eating of having is very few, does not even have, and cause the girth of a garment uneven, the uniformity of colony is poor, affects the rate of animals delivered to the slaughter-house.Sometimes overcrowding during robbing food, may make indivedual pig injured, especially small and weak pig and conceived pig.
Yard feeding pattern traditional as can be seen here and equipment cannot reach the requirement of people, and present people need the feeding facility of a set of science to improve and improve the management mode of raising pigs.

Embodiment
The technological means realized to make utility model, creating feature, reach object and effect is easy to understand, lower combination specifically illustrates, and sets forth the utility model further.
As shown in Figure 1, one boar food device, wherein, comprise: culturing area 1 and feeding region 2, a division board 3 is provided with between culturing area 1 and feeding region 2, culturing area 1 and feeding region 2 are separated by division board 3, after avoiding that feeding in the past occurs, swinery is grabbed the event causing indivedual pig injured and occurs;
Culturing area 1 comprises: pigsty 101 and polylith demarcation strip 102, and demarcation strip 102 is positioned at pigsty, and each demarcation strip 102 is all vertical at the side of division board 3;
Feeding region 2 comprises: trough 201, sliding-rail groove 202, feed support 203 and feedbox 204, trough 201 is located at division board 5 and is deviated from side in demarcation strip, sliding-rail groove 202 is located at trough 201 and is deviated from side in division board 5, feed support 203 is located on the upside of sliding-rail groove 202, pulley 205 is provided with bottom feed support 203, pulley 205 is located in sliding-rail groove 202, feed support 203 top is located at by feedbox 204, further, feed support 203 supports feedbox 204, and the pulley 205 utilizing feed support 203 bottom surface to be provided with carries out displacement in sliding-rail groove 202.
In specific embodiment of the utility model, the pyramidal of feedbox 204 is to lower convexity, the bottom surface of feedbox 204 is provided with an opening 206, opening 206 place is provided with a hopper 207, the first gate 208 is provided with between the bottom surface of feedbox 204 and hopper 207, the bottom surface of hopper 207 is provided with the second gate 209, further, first open the first gate 208 and close the second gate 209, secondly feed is poured into by feedbox 204, feed flows into downwards in hopper 207 along feedbox 204, finally close the first gate 208 and open the second gate 209 again, feed is thrown in in trough 201.
In specific embodiment of the utility model, the end face of feedbox 204 is provided with a lid 210, the outer ring of lid 210 and the inner ring of feedbox 204 match, lid 210 upper surface is provided with handle 211, the downward tapered protrusion of lid 210 bottom surface, the bottom surface of lid 210 bottom surface and feedbox 204 matches, further, when the feed in feedbox 204 blocks, impel feed to go out to extrude from hopper 207 by pushing lid 210, the feed simultaneously in lid 210 pairs of feedboxes 204 blocks and prevents dust or impurity from entering in feedbox 204.
In specific embodiment of the utility model, multiple feed mouth 301 is provided with in division board 3, multiple feed mouth 301 is equally spaced along division board 3 longitudinal arrangement, further, when pig will eat feed, then head needs through feed mouth 301, the head that can only hold a pig in the size of this each feed mouth 301 passes, and avoids occurring between each pig to grab food.
In specific embodiment of the utility model, a demarcation strip 102 is all furnished with between feed mouth 301 and feed mouth 301, demarcation strip 102 is equal with the spacing of demarcation strip 102, further, play and the pig of every only feed is separated, can not collide when making them on the feed, avoid indivedual pig injured.
In specific embodiment of the utility model, the two ends of sliding-rail groove 202 are equipped with a limited block 212, limit by limited block 212 scope that feed support 203 slides in sliding-rail groove 202.
In specific embodiment of the utility model, hopper 207 is positioned at directly over trough 201, and further, the feed in feedbox 204 can be poured directly in trough 201 through hopper 207.
In embodiment of the present utility model, first the first gate 208 is closed, feed is imported in feedbox 204, feed support 203 is promoted after filling up feedbox 204, close the first gate 208 when hopper 207 is in feed mouth 301 front and open the second gate 209 again, feed now in hopper 207 is poured in trough 201, so repeatedly, feed is rendered in the trough 201 before each feed mouth 301, the quantitative input of food is completed with this, if there is feed to hoard in feedbox 204 in launch process, lid 210 is then needed to press down, after having thrown in feed, every pig has entered in the separated region of demarcation strip 102, head is leant out feed mouth 301 and can obtain oneself desired quantitative food, and separated region can only enter a pig when avoiding on the feed, the plunder between pig.
